These frosted glass finished protective covers as fitted to our California kitchen have been computer cut to the exact size of both burner / sink and the fridge glass work tops and can be applied in minutes using the supplied 3M squeege and a misting of soapy water solution using an old household spray bottle.

Holes are pre cut in both of the protective covers to accommodate the circular gas strut fixing on both work tops and act as a guide when fitting. The soapy solution enables you to move the protector around until it is in the correct position before squeeging the solution to the edges to leave it stuck in place.

The covers are also really easy to remove should you wish to replace them with a new set in the future, rather like a mobile phone screen protector.

Fitting Worktop Protection
We ordered some of the work top protectors and as we live locally I arranged with Andrew to collect them. Not only was he happy for us to collect them, but very kindly offered to fit them for us. Which we gratefully accepted.
The secret is to get the glass really, really clean with a lint free duster, baby wipe or similar. Peel off the paper backing, liberally spray both surfaces with soapy water, then apply the vinyl surface to the glass. Move it around until it is a perfect fit. It is a smidgeon narrower than the glass 1/16". Then squeegee the excess water out. They are a perfect fit and cut neatly around the metal studs.

Andrew was so meticulous about getting the surface clean as even a spec of grit will be very conspicuous and the finished effect is perfect.
We've not had the spill test yet, but Andrew has and reports no adverse effects.
